Skip to content
This repository
branch: master

Apr 03, 2014

  1. pirxpilot

    Release 0.1.0

    authored April 02, 2014
  2. pirxpilot

    add demo links

    authored April 02, 2014

Apr 02, 2014

  1. Arpad Borsos

    Merge pull request #26 from code42day/constrain-dates-bounds

    Constrain dates
    authored April 02, 2014
  2. pirxpilot

    DayRange fixes: inherit from Bounds

    authored March 13, 2013
  3. pirxpilot

    Document new `min` and `max` methods

    authored February 17, 2013
  4. pirxpilot

    Implement dates restriction

    Calendar has new `min` and `max` functions to define inclusive range of
    valid dates.
    
    Range checking is performed by DayRange implemented using Bounds.
    When rendering calendar dates ourside of the range are rendered with
    `invalid` CSS class, so that can they be styled differently from valid
    dates.
    
    Days will not fire 'change' event for invalid (out-of-range) dates.
    Calendar ignores attempts to select invalid date, although is allows to
    show it.
    authored February 16, 2013
  5. Arpad Borsos

    Merge pull request #36 from code42day/fix-mouse-cursor

    restore pointer cursor for days
    authored April 02, 2014
  6. pirxpilot

    restore pointer cursor for days

    days `a` nodes don't have `href` attribute, so browsers do not think
    they are clickable
    by forcing cursor to pointer we let user know that clickin on days is
    possible
    authored April 01, 2014
  7. pirxpilot

    Options for jshint

    authored February 17, 2013

Apr 01, 2014

  1. pirxpilot

    add `test` target in Makefile

    mocha as devel dependency
    authored February 17, 2013

Jan 27, 2014

  1. Dominic Barnes

    Merge pull request #35 from component/ie8_compat

    IE8 Compatibility
    authored January 27, 2014

Jan 20, 2014

  1. Dominic Barnes

    Adding some new dependencies for IE8 support

     * component/bind for Function#bind
     * component/map for Array#map
     * yields/empty because IE8 breaks out with innerHTML on some elements
     * stephenmathieson/normalize to normalize event handlers
    authored January 20, 2014
  2. Dominic Barnes

    including DOCTYPE so IE8 does not freak out

    authored January 20, 2014

Jan 05, 2014

  1. Dominic Barnes

    Merge pull request #34 from component/browserify-deps-update

    Updating Browserify Dependencies (dom-events -> component/event)
    authored January 05, 2014
  2. Dominic Barnes

    fixing browserify dependencies for dom-events -> component/event change

    authored January 05, 2014
  3. Dominic Barnes

    fixing example (no longer using jQuery)

    authored January 04, 2014
  4. Dominic Barnes

    adding dependencies to component.json, using component/event instead …

    …of dom-events
    authored January 04, 2014
  5. Dominic Barnes

    Merge branch 'master' of github.com:defunctzombie/calendar into defun…

    …ctzombie-master
    authored January 04, 2014

Oct 09, 2013

  1. Jonathan Ong

    Merge pull request #31 from repoify/add/repository

    Add repository field to readme
    authored October 09, 2013

Aug 30, 2013

  1. Roman Shtylman

    add missing dependencies to package.json

    authored August 30, 2013
  2. Roman Shtylman

    fix day traversal

    <a> tag events need to prevent the default behavior
    authored August 30, 2013

Aug 23, 2013

  1. Roman Shtylman

    remove jquery dependency

    - add deps to package.json to package with browserify
    authored August 23, 2013

Aug 21, 2013

  1. Forbes Lindesay

    add repository field to readme

    authored August 21, 2013

Jun 06, 2013

  1. TJ Holowaychuk

    Release 0.0.5

    authored June 06, 2013
  2. TJ Holowaychuk

    fix tags

    authored June 06, 2013

May 31, 2013

  1. TJ Holowaychuk

    Release 0.0.4

  2. TJ Holowaychuk

    pin deps

  3. TJ Holowaychuk

    Merge pull request #27 from code42day/fix-bug-on-31th

    Fix short months selection on 31th of the month
  4. pirxpilot

    Fix short months selection on 31th of the month

    Due to javascript date peculiarities calendar did not work properly on
    the last day of long months (for example on 5/31)
    
    onclick handler looked (more or less) like this
    
    date = new Date;
    date.setYear(year);
    date.setMonth(month);
    date.setDay(day);
    
    However if current date is 2013-05-31 trying to set month to - for
    example - September, would temporarily create an invalid date
    (2013-09-31) which Date object prompty 'fixes' for us converting it to
    2013-10-01
    
    New code sets year, month, and day in the Date constructor thus avoiding
    the issue.
    authored May 31, 2013

Mar 13, 2013

  1. TJ Holowaychuk

    Merge pull request #23 from code42day/infastructure-fixes

    Infastructure fixes
    authored March 13, 2013
  2. TJ Holowaychuk

    Merge pull request #22 from code42day/leap-year

    Leap year
    authored March 13, 2013

Feb 17, 2013

  1. pirxpilot

    fix example - `two` is not defined

    use `small` and `large` calendars in event listeners for `one` calendar
    authored February 16, 2013
  2. pirxpilot

    Makefile: Calendar -> calendar, Days -> days

    calendar.js and days.js needs to be lowercase for `make` to work on case
    sensistive file systems
    authored February 16, 2013
  3. pirxpilot

    Fix leap year calculation

    Years divisible by 400 *are* leap years (iow: 2/29/2000 was on Tuesday)
    see: http://en.wikipedia.org/wiki/Leap_year#Algorithm
    authored February 16, 2013
  4. pirxpilot

    Use year when calculating number of days in a month

    Year number is needed for leap day calculation to work
    authored February 16, 2013
Something went wrong with that request. Please try again.